The Downfalls of Poor Leadership

Poor leadership can wreak havoc on an organization, causing chaos, confusion, and ultimately leading to a decline in morale and productivity. When leaders lack vision, fail to communicate effectively, and do not inspire their team, employees may become disengaged and lose motivation. This can result in missed deadlines, increased turnover, and low job satisfaction. Without strong leadership, goals may remain unmet, conflicts can arise, and trust within the team can erode. Ultimately, the downfalls of poor leadership can have a ripple effect, impacting the success and sustainability of the organization as a whole.
